Question
5-10

Senior Backend Engineer

3/25/2026

The engineer will design and implement core backend infrastructure for a distributed Ground Control System, driving technical decisions regarding service architecture, communication patterns, and scalability. Responsibilities include building systems for mission planning, state management, orchestration, and developing real-time data pipelines for telemetry and video streams.

Working Hours

40 hours/week

Company Size

51-200 employees

Language

English

Visa Sponsorship

No

About The Company
Airobotics Ltd. is an Israeli manufacturer and operator of Unmanned Aircraft systems deployed as mission-critical strategic aerial infrastructure for government and commercial entities all over the world. Airobotics provides trusted autonomous drones used for Safe & Smart Cities, Defense, Homeland Security, industrial projects and facilities, performing various automated aerial missions 24/7 with no human intervention. Founded in 2014, Airobotics combines expertise in aerospace hardware design, robust electronic systems, cutting-edge software engineering, and years of experience in commercial drone operations across a variety of environments. This blend of experience and expertise has enabled Airobotics to create the world's most reliable and effective autonomous unmanned systems and to implement them as mission-critical infrastructures to address the needs of the most complex environments in the world. Airobotics systems enable end-users to operate drones in real-time anytime, anywhere for aerial data capture and analysis, aerial delivery, and interception. Together with customized data analysis platforms, Airobotics systems enable faster, more effective, and more efficient operations and fully informed critical decision-making. The Airobotics Optimus is a fully automated drone system, comprising a drone, an airbase, swappable payloads and designated software. The system has a wide range of regulatory certifications and is the first of its kind in the global market to include a robotic arm swapping payloads and batteries for 24/7 continuous, unmanned aerial missions. The Airobotics Iron-Drone System is a fully automated interceptor drone launched from a designated pod, flying autonomously, and intercepting malicious drones.
About the Role

Airobotics is a leading company specializing in the development and manufacturing of autonomous drone systems. Its solutions combine hardware, software, and AI-driven technologies to support complex, large-scale operations. Airobotics works primarily with defense industries, such as military and law enforcement agencies worldwide. The company is part of Ondas Holdings and operates as a wholly owned subsidiary.

We are building a new engineering group responsible for the next generation of Ground Control Station (GCS) and mission systems for autonomous platforms.

The platform acts as the operational backbone for autonomous systems in the field, including:

  • Real-time platform telemetry and control
  • Mission planning, validation, and execution
  • Multi-platform orchestration (drones, docking stations, edge nodes)
  • Video streaming and real-time data pipelines

The system is designed as a distributed, real-time platform integrating telemetry, video streams, mission logic, and operational services into a unified control environment.

As a senior engineer, you will help design and build the core backend infrastructure and influence system architecture, engineering practices, and technical direction while collaborating closely with autonomy, frontend, and embedded teams.


Responsibilities

  • Design and implement backend services for a distributed Ground Control System
  • Drive technical decisions around service architecture, communication patterns, and scalability
  • Build systems for mission planning, validation, and execution
  • Develop services responsible for platform state management and orchestration
  • Implement real-time data pipelines for telemetry and video streams
  • Design low-latency communication mechanisms across distributed components
  • Contribute to system reliability, observability, and performance optimization

Requirements

  • Strong experience building backend systems in production environments
  • Excellent software engineering and programming fundamentals
  • Experience developing backend services using modern programming languages (e.g., Java, Python, Go, C++, Rust, or similar)
  • Experience designing distributed systems or microservice architectures
  • Strong understanding of concurrency, system design, and performance
  • Experience with event-driven or real-time systems
  • Familiarity with distributed communication or messaging systems (Kafka, gRPC, WebSockets, or similar)

Nice to Have:

  • Experience with real-time data pipelines (telemetry or video)
  • Familiarity with video streaming technologies (GStreamer, WebRTC, FFmpeg)
  • Experience with geospatial systems or GIS
  • Background in robotics, drones, or autonomous platforms
  • Familiarity with ROS2, MAVLink, or similar protocols


Key Skills
Backend SystemsDistributed SystemsSystem ArchitectureJavaPythonGoC++RustMicroservice ArchitecturesConcurrencySystem DesignReal-time SystemsKafkagRPCWebSocketsTelemetry
Categories
EngineeringSoftwareTechnologyScience & ResearchSecurity & Safety
Apply Now

Please let Airobotics know you found this job on InterviewPal. This helps us grow!

Apply Now
Prepare for Your Interview

We scan and aggregate real interview questions reported by candidates across thousands of companies. This role already has a tailored question set waiting for you.

Elevate your application

Generate a resume, cover letter, or prepare with our AI mock interviewer tailored to this job's requirements.